How To Experience Joy and Peace Through God's Promises

Ask, believe, and Receive
Mark 11:24 Therefore I say to you,
whatever things you ask when you pray,
believe that you receive them, and you will have them.
John 16:24 Until now you have asked nothing in My name.
Ask, and you will receive, that your joy may be full.

Prayer must be based on God's word
John 15:7 If you abide in Me, and My words abide in you,
you will ask what you desire, and it shall be done for you.

Thank God before you see a promise fulfilled
John 11:41 Then they took away the stone from the place where the dead man was lying.
And Jesus lifted up His eyes and said, “Father, I thank You that You have heard Me.

Try This Gratitude Exercise: Write the following list of promises down and say "Thank you Lord.." for each promise. Also try the sandwich approach of saying thanks twice for the same promise, but in between say "I'm so glad I don't have to worry about _____________ ". Fill in the blank with whatever problem that the bible promise solves.

God wants you to have joy and thankfulness
1 Thessalonians 5:16-18
Rejoice always, pray without ceasing, in everything give thanks;
for this is the will of God in Christ Jesus for you.
God fills you with joy and peace by faith
Romans 15:13 Now may the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ace in believing,
that you may abound in hope by the power of the Holy Spirit.

The Lord's Joy Brings Healing and Strength
Proverbs 17:22 A merry heart does good, like medicine...
Nehemiah 8:10 “…..the joy of the Lord is your strength”

Joy In Knowing That Trials Produce Perseverance
Romans 5:3 And not only that, but we also glory in tribulations,
knowing that tribulation produces perseverance

Hope in God's glory shining through you
Job 23:10 But He knows the way that I take;
When He has tested me, I shall come forth as gold.
Colossians 1:27 ... God willed to make known what are
the riches of the glory of this mystery among the Gentiles:
which is Christ in you, the hope of glory.

God will make everything work out for your good
Romans 8:28 And we know that all things
work together for good to those who love God,
to those who are the called according to His purpose.
